feat: add CertFP authentication with SASL EXTERNAL
Per-network, per-nick client certificates (EC P-256, self-signed, 10-year validity) stored as combined PEM files. Authentication cascade: SASL EXTERNAL > SASL PLAIN > NickServ IDENTIFY. New commands: GENCERT, CERTFP, DELCERT. GENCERT auto-registers the fingerprint with NickServ CERT ADD when the network is connected. Includes email verification module for NickServ registration and expanded NickServ interaction (IDENTIFY, REGISTER, VERIFY).

## CertFP Authentication
|
||||
|
||||
The bouncer supports client certificate fingerprint (CertFP) authentication
|
||||
via SASL EXTERNAL. Each certificate is unique per (network, nick) pair and
|
||||
stored as a combined PEM file at `{data_dir}/certs/{network}/{nick}.pem`.
|
||||
|
||||
### Authentication Cascade
|
||||
|
||||
When connecting, the bouncer selects the strongest available method:
|
||||
|
||||
| Priority | Method | Condition |
|
||||
|----------|--------|-----------|
|
||||
| 1 | SASL EXTERNAL | Stored creds + cert file exists |
|
||||
| 2 | SASL PLAIN | Stored creds, no cert |
|
||||
| 3 | NickServ IDENTIFY | Fallback after SASL failure |
|
||||
|
||||
### Setup
|
||||
|
||||
1. Generate a certificate:
|
||||
```
|
||||
/msg *bouncer GENCERT libera
|
||||
```
|
||||
This creates an EC P-256 self-signed cert (10-year validity) and
|
||||
auto-sends `NickServ CERT ADD <fingerprint>` if the network is connected.
|
||||
|
||||
2. Reconnect to use CertFP:
|
||||
```
|
||||
/msg *bouncer RECONNECT libera
|
||||
```
|
||||
The bouncer will now present the client certificate during TLS and
|
||||
authenticate via SASL EXTERNAL.
|
||||
|
||||
3. Verify the fingerprint is registered:
|
||||
```
|
||||
/msg *bouncer CERTFP libera
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
### Certificate Storage
|
||||
|
||||
Certificates are stored alongside the config file:
|
||||
|
||||
```
|
||||
{data_dir}/certs/
|
||||
libera/
|
||||
fabesune.pem # cert + private key (chmod 600)
|
||||
oftc/
|
||||
mynick.pem
|
||||
```

@@ -0,0 +1,126 @@
|
||||
"""Client certificate management for CertFP authentication."""
|
||||
|
||||
from __future__ import annotations
|
||||
|
||||
import datetime
|
||||
import logging
|
||||
import os
|
||||
from pathlib import Path
|
||||
|
||||
from cryptography import x509
|
||||
from cryptography.hazmat.primitives import hashes, serialization
|
||||
from cryptography.hazmat.primitives.asymmetric import ec
|
||||
from cryptography.x509.oid import NameOID
|
||||
|
||||
log = logging.getLogger(__name__)
|
||||
|
||||
_VALIDITY_DAYS = 3650 # ~10 years
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
def cert_path(data_dir: Path, network: str, nick: str) -> Path:
|
||||
"""Return the PEM file path for a (network, nick) pair."""
|
||||
return data_dir / "certs" / network / f"{nick}.pem"
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
def generate_cert(data_dir: Path, network: str, nick: str) -> Path:
|
||||
"""Generate a self-signed EC P-256 client certificate.
|
||||
|
||||
Creates a combined PEM file (cert + key) at the standard path.
|
||||
Returns the path to the generated file.
|
||||
"""
|
||||
pem = cert_path(data_dir, network, nick)
|
||||
pem.parent.mkdir(parents=True, exist_ok=True)
|
||||
|
||||
key = ec.generate_private_key(ec.SECP256R1())
|
||||
|
||||
subject = issuer = x509.Name([
|
||||
x509.NameAttribute(NameOID.COMMON_NAME, f"{nick}@{network}"),
|
||||
])
|
||||
|
||||
now = datetime.datetime.now(datetime.timezone.utc)
|
||||
cert = (
|
||||
x509.CertificateBuilder()
|
||||
.subject_name(subject)
|
||||
.issuer_name(issuer)
|
||||
.public_key(key.public_key())
|
||||
.serial_number(x509.random_serial_number())
|
||||
.not_valid_before(now)
|
||||
.not_valid_after(now + datetime.timedelta(days=_VALIDITY_DAYS))
|
||||
.sign(key, hashes.SHA256())
|
||||
)
|
||||
|
||||
key_bytes = key.private_bytes(
|
||||
encoding=serialization.Encoding.PEM,
|
||||
format=serialization.PrivateFormat.PKCS8,
|
||||
encryption_algorithm=serialization.NoEncryption(),
|
||||
)
|
||||
cert_bytes = cert.public_bytes(serialization.Encoding.PEM)
|
||||
|
||||
pem.write_bytes(cert_bytes + key_bytes)
|
||||
os.chmod(pem, 0o600)
|
||||
|
||||
log.info("generated cert %s (CN=%s@%s)", pem, nick, network)
|
||||
return pem
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
def fingerprint(pem_path: Path) -> str:
|
||||
"""Return the SHA-256 fingerprint in colon-separated uppercase hex.
|
||||
|
||||
This is the format NickServ expects for CERT ADD.
|
||||
"""
|
||||
cert_data = pem_path.read_bytes()
|
||||
cert = x509.load_pem_x509_certificate(cert_data)
|
||||
digest = cert.fingerprint(hashes.SHA256())
|
||||
return ":".join(f"{b:02X}" for b in digest)
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
def has_cert(data_dir: Path, network: str, nick: str) -> bool:
|
||||
"""Check whether a certificate exists for (network, nick)."""
|
||||
return cert_path(data_dir, network, nick).is_file()
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
def delete_cert(data_dir: Path, network: str, nick: str) -> bool:
|
||||
"""Delete the certificate for (network, nick). Returns True if removed."""
|
||||
pem = cert_path(data_dir, network, nick)
|
||||
if pem.is_file():
|
||||
pem.unlink()
|
||||
log.info("deleted cert %s", pem)
|
||||
# Clean up empty directories
|
||||
try:
|
||||
pem.parent.rmdir()
|
||||
except OSError:
|
||||
pass
|
||||
return True
|
||||
return False
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
def list_certs(
|
||||
data_dir: Path, network: str | None = None,
|
||||
) -> list[tuple[str, str, str]]:
|
||||
"""List certificates as (network, nick, fingerprint) tuples.
|
||||
|
||||
If network is given, only lists certs for that network.
|
||||
"""
|
||||
certs_dir = data_dir / "certs"
|
||||
if not certs_dir.is_dir():
|
||||
return []
|
||||
|
||||
results: list[tuple[str, str, str]] = []
|
||||
|
||||
if network:
|
||||
net_dir = certs_dir / network
|
||||
if net_dir.is_dir():
|
||||
for pem_file in sorted(net_dir.glob("*.pem")):
|
||||
nick = pem_file.stem
|
||||
fp = fingerprint(pem_file)
|
||||
results.append((network, nick, fp))
|
||||
else:
|
||||
for net_dir in sorted(certs_dir.iterdir()):
|
||||
if not net_dir.is_dir():
|
||||
continue
|
||||
for pem_file in sorted(net_dir.glob("*.pem")):
|
||||
nick = pem_file.stem
|
||||
fp = fingerprint(pem_file)
|
||||
results.append((net_dir.name, nick, fp))
|
||||
|
||||
return results

# --- SASL capability negotiation ---
|
||||
if msg.command == "CAP" and len(msg.params) >= 3:
|
||||
subcommand = msg.params[1].upper()
|
||||
caps = msg.params[2].strip().lower()
|
||||
if subcommand == "ACK" and "sasl" in caps:
|
||||
log.info("[%s] SASL capability acknowledged, using %s",
|
||||
self.cfg.name, self._sasl_mechanism)
|
||||
await self.send_raw("AUTHENTICATE", self._sasl_mechanism or "PLAIN")
|
||||
elif subcommand == "NAK" and "sasl" in caps:
|
||||
log.warning("[%s] SASL not supported by server", self.cfg.name)
|
||||
self._status("SASL not supported, falling back")
|
||||
self._sasl_nick = ""
|
||||
self._sasl_pass = ""
|
||||
self._sasl_mechanism = ""
|
||||
await self.send_raw("CAP", "END")
|
||||
return
|
||||
|
||||
if msg.command == "AUTHENTICATE" and msg.params and msg.params[0] == "+":
|
||||
if self._sasl_mechanism == "EXTERNAL":
|
||||
# EXTERNAL: send account name (nick) base64-encoded
|
||||
encoded = base64.b64encode(self._sasl_nick.encode()).decode()
|
||||
await self.send_raw("AUTHENTICATE", encoded)
|
||||
log.debug("[%s] sent SASL EXTERNAL identity", self.cfg.name)
|
||||
elif self._sasl_nick and self._sasl_pass:
|
||||
# PLAIN: nick\0nick\0pass
|
||||
cred = f"{self._sasl_nick}\0{self._sasl_nick}\0{self._sasl_pass}"
|
||||
encoded = base64.b64encode(cred.encode()).decode()
|
||||
await self.send_raw("AUTHENTICATE", encoded)
|
||||
log.debug("[%s] sent SASL PLAIN credentials", self.cfg.name)
|
||||
else:
|
||||
await self.send_raw("AUTHENTICATE", "*") # abort
|
||||
return
|
||||
|
||||
if msg.command == "903":
|
||||
# RPL_SASLSUCCESS
|
||||
log.info("[%s] SASL %s authentication successful", self.cfg.name, self._sasl_mechanism)
|
||||
self._status(f"SASL {self._sasl_mechanism} authenticated as {self._sasl_nick}")
|
||||
self._sasl_complete.set()
|
||||
await self.send_raw("CAP", "END")
|
||||
return
|
||||
|
||||
if msg.command in ("902", "904", "905"):
|
||||
# ERR_NICKLOCKED / ERR_SASLFAIL / ERR_SASLTOOLONG
|
||||
reason = msg.params[-1] if msg.params else msg.command
|
||||
log.warning("[%s] SASL %s failed (%s): %s",
|
||||
self.cfg.name, self._sasl_mechanism, msg.command, reason)
|
||||
self._status(f"SASL {self._sasl_mechanism} failed, falling back")
|
||||
self._sasl_nick = ""
|
||||
self._sasl_pass = ""
|
||||
self._sasl_mechanism = ""
|
||||
await self.send_raw("CAP", "END")
|
||||
return
|
||||
|
||||
if msg.command in ("906", "908"):
|
||||
# ERR_SASLABORTED / RPL_SASLMECHS
|
||||
await self.send_raw("CAP", "END")
|
||||
return
